What is the average salary in Williston, VT?
Williston, VT, offers a range of salary opportunities across different industries. The average yearly salary stands at approximately $53,053, making it a competitive place for job seekers. Many workers earn between $31,420 and $133,000 annually, depending on their occupation and experience.
The most common salary brackets show that 25.73% of workers earn around $31,420, while 26.34% earn about $40,655 each year. A notable percentage, 15.43%, earn closer to $49,889. Higher-paying sectors include finance and healthcare, where salaries often exceed $68,358. For those in specialized or managerial roles, salaries can reach up to $133,000.

How does the cost of living in Williston, VT compare to the national average?

The cost of living in Williston, Vermont, presents both opportunities and challenges for residents. Housing costs, for instance, are significantly lower in Williston, with an index of 85 compared to the nationwide average of 100. This means that housing expenses are about 15% less than the national average, potentially making it easier for individuals to find affordable living arrangements.
When it comes to other essentials, Williston shows mixed results. Groceries have a cost of living index of 105, indicating that they are 5% more expensive than the national average. Utilities also cost slightly less, with an index of 95, which is 5% below the average. Transportation costs, at 90, are 10% lower than the national average, offering some relief to those commuting or managing travel expenses. Healthcare costs, however, are notably higher, with an index of 110, meaning they are 10% above the national average. Miscellaneous expenses follow closely behind, with an index of 95, suggesting they are 5% below the national average. Overall, Williston provides a balanced cost of living that varies across different categories.
